Classy API to Google Sheets Sync

This Python script automatically syncs transaction data from the Classy API to a Google Sheet on a daily basis.

📋 Overview

  • Source: Classy API Campaign #656775 (approximately 14,000 transactions)
  • Destination: Google Sheet (ID: 1xCr8VSAjx-7xmD0mPtWX0gxCn_72YjF_bw20ILeXDpo)
  • Schedule: Daily at 6:00 AM via cron job
  • Update Method: Full refresh (clears and repopulates all data)

🔧 Troubleshooting

Common Issues

  1. "credentials.json not found"

    • Follow setup_google_auth.md to create the file
    • Ensure it's in the correct directory
  2. "Permission denied" on Google Sheet

    • Share the sheet with your service account email
    • Grant "Editor" permissions
  3. Classy API authentication failed

    • Check your client ID and secret in config.py
    • Verify the API endpoint is accessible
  4. Cron job not running

    • Check cron service: sudo service cron status
    • Verify cron job exists: crontab -l
    • Check cron logs: tail -f logs/cron.log

🔒 Security

  • Credentials: Never commit credentials.json to version control
  • API Keys: Stored in config.py - consider using environment variables for production
  • Permissions: Service account only has access to explicitly shared sheets
  • Logs: May contain sensitive data - secure appropriately

📈 Performance

The script is optimized for large datasets:

  • Pagination: Handles 14,000+ transactions automatically
  • Rate Limiting: Respects API limits with delays between requests
  • Batch Processing: Efficient Google Sheets updates
  • Error Recovery: Retries failed requests automatically
